Birmingham vs Leeds United FA Cup tie moved to Sunday, 12pm kick-off on TNT Sports

Article image:Birmingham vs Leeds United FA Cup tie moved to Sunday, 12pm kick-off on TNT Sports

The FA has confirmed Leeds United’s FA Cup fourth-round trip to Birmingham City will be played on Sunday 15th February at 12pm, after a switch from a 2pm kick-off the day before. The match will be shown live in the UK on TNT Sports 3 and on the Discovery+ app.

United reached round four for the fourth consecutive season with a 3-1 win at Derby County, overturning Ben Brereton Diaz’s 35th-minute opener. Second-half goals from Wilfried Gnonto, Ao Tanaka and James Justin sealed progress.

Birmingham, 14th in the Championship, are also in round four for the fourth straight year after a 3-2 victory at Cambridge United. They led 3-0 before seeing off a late rally from the League Two side.

Before the Derby tie, Daniel Farke spoke of aiming for a deep run while accepting winning a major competition is not realistic for a promoted side. He said his team have shown they can beat top opponents in quarter-finals, semi-finals and finals.

The clubs last met in January 2024, when Leeds won 3-0 at Elland Road through Patrick Bamford, Daniel James and Crysencio Summerville. Leeds have three wins in the last four meetings, though they lost 1-0 at St Andrew’s in August 2023 to a Lukas Jutkiewicz penalty.

Their most recent FA Cup tie was in January 2013, a 1-1 draw at Elland Road followed by a 2-1 comeback win for Leeds in the replay at St Andrew’s. Ross McCormack and El Hadji Diouf scored in that game.
